What degree do you need to be a plant geneticist?

A bachelor’s degree in biology, botany or biochemistry is required. Depending upon the employer and nature of the job, a master’s degree or doctorate (especially if doing research or teaching) may be required.

What is a plant geneticist called?

A plant geneticist is a scientist involved with the study of genetics in botany. Plant genetics played a key role in the modern-day theories of heredity, beginning with Gregor Mendel’s study of pea plants in the 19th century.

How much do plant breeders get paid?

With around five years’ experience, salaries can reach £25,000. Highly experienced plant breeders can earn £40,000+. Pay tends to be higher in the public sector. In the private sector, additional benefits might include a company car and medical insurance. Pay is often performance related.

What does a plant breeder/geneticist do?

As a plant breeder/geneticist you will work on improving the quality and performance of existing agricultural and horticultural crops and create new varieties of plants. Plant breeders/geneticists aim to develop useful traits, such as disease resistance and drought tolerance; they also work to improve characteristics such as appearance.
